Importance of Proper Shoe Materials and Designs

Proper shoe materials and designs play a crucial role in alleviating plantar fasciitis symptoms. Materials such as leather, mesh, or synthetic materials can provide breathability, support, and cushioning essential for comfortable walking on the golf course. The shoe’s design can also affect the distribution of pressure on the foot, which can contribute to discomfort or pain.

A shoe with a sturdy heel counter can provide essential support and stability, reducing the risk of heel slips and associated injuries. The use of shock-absorbing midsoles and a supportive arch can also help to alleviate plantar fasciitis symptoms. When selecting golf shoes, look for materials and designs that prioritize comfort and support for the foot.

Key Features of Golf Shoes for Plantar Fasciitis

When shopping for golf shoes designed to alleviate plantar fasciitis, consider the following key features:

  • Sturdy heel counter and strong ankle support to maintain stability and reduce the risk of heel slips.
  • Moderate to high arch support to reduce pressure on the plantar fascia and alleviate pain.
  • Good cushioning and shock absorption to reduce the stress on the heel and plantar fascia upon heel strike.
  • Breathable, moisture-wicking materials to prevent blisters and reduce discomfort.
  • A comfortable fit with ample room for the toes and a secure, snug heel fit.

A good golf shoe for plantar fasciitis should incorporate these features to provide the necessary support and comfort for golfers with this condition, allowing them to play the sport with precision and accuracy.

Key Features for Comfort and Support

When selecting a golf shoe for plantar fasciitis relief, consider the following key features:

  • Arch Support: A golf shoe with a supportive arch can help distribute weight evenly, reducing pressure on the plantar fascia. Look for shoes with a strong, stable arch that can provide the necessary support.
  • Cushioning: Adequate cushioning can help absorb shock and reduce stress on the foot. Choose golf shoes with thick, high-quality midsoles that provide sufficient cushioning.
  • Ankle Stability: Ankle instability can exacerbate plantar fasciitis. Select golf shoes with sturdy ankle collars and supportive materials that can help maintain stability throughout the swing.
  • Moisture Management: Keeping the foot dry can help prevent irritation and discomfort. Look for golf shoes with breathable, moisture-wicking materials that can help regulate foot temperature.
  • Soft, Breathable Upper: A soft, breathable upper can provide comfort and flexibility. Choose golf shoes with high-quality materials that can accommodate foot movement without restriction.

Types of Orthotics and Their Effects

Different types of orthotics can have varying effects on the overall comfort and stability of golf shoes for individuals with plantar fasciitis.

– Arch Supports: These are one of the most common types of orthotics used in golf shoes for plantar fasciitis relief. Arch supports can help redistribute pressure and stress away from the plantar fascia, reducing pain and discomfort. However, the effectiveness of arch supports can depend greatly on the individual’s foot shape and the quality of the orthotic device.

– Metatarsal Pads: These are designed to provide additional support and cushioning for the metatarsal bones in the foot. Metatarsal pads can help alleviate pain and pressure in the forefoot, which can be particularly problematic for individuals with plantar fasciitis.

Support and Stability Features

Golf shoes designed for optimal support and comfort often feature technologies that provide superior stability and support for golfers with plantar fasciitis. Some of these features include:

  • Stiffened heel counters help prevent excessive pronation and supination, reducing stress on the plantar fascia.
  • Cushionedmidsoles with gel or air pockets absorb shock and provide added support for the midfoot and heel.
  • Ortholite footbeds or custom insoles offer additional arch support and shock absorption, helping to reduce strain on the plantar fascia.

Q: What is plantar fasciitis, and how does it affect golfing?

Plantar fasciitis is a common condition characterized by inflammation of the plantar fascia, a band of tissue that supports the arch of the foot. It can cause pain and stiffness in the heel and bottom of the foot, making it difficult to walk, run, or engage in activities that involve repetitive stress on the foot, including golfing.

Q: What features should I look for in a golf shoe to alleviate plantar fasciitis symptoms?

When shopping for golf shoes to alleviate plantar fasciitis symptoms, look for features such as arch support, cushioning, and ankle stability. These features can help reduce stress on the foot and alleviate pain associated with plantar fasciitis.
